Several observational studies have confirmed the relationship between thyroid hormones and coronavirus disease 2019 (COVID-19), but this correlation remains controversial. We performed a two-sample Mendelian randomization (MR) analysis based on largest publicly available summary datasets. Summary statistics with 49 269 individuals for free thyroxine (FT4) 54 288 stimulating hormone (TSH) were used as exposure instruments.
